Buying Guide

Look for strong reader ratings

Choose titles with consistently high ratings (4.5★ and above) to increase the likelihood the advice resonates and is well-edited

Prioritize practical rituals and exercises

Books that offer concrete rituals, step-by-step practices, or reflection prompts deliver actionable transformation you can integrate into daily home routines

Match tone to your change process

Select voices that fit your needs—spiritual frameworks for meaning work, rules-based approaches for structure, or memoirs for inspiration and relatability

Consider author background and approach

Authors who combine personal experience with established frameworks (e.g., mind-spirit perspectives or recovery narratives) often provide both empathy and practical tools

Value score and length matter

Balance value score and review count against book length—concise guides with high scores can be easier to complete and apply in everyday life
